NACE International have announced NACE standard RP0502-2002, "Pipeline external corrosion direct assessment methodology," a new publication written by NACE Task Group 041.

NACE standard RP0502-2002 covers the NACE external corrosion direct assessment (ECDA) process for buried ferrous piping systems. ECDA is a structured process that is intended to improve safety by assessing and reducing the impact of external corrosion on pipeline integrity.

By identifying and addressing corrosion activity and repairing corrosion defects and remediating the cause, ECDA proactively seeks to prevent external corrosion defects from growing to a size that is large enough to impact structural integrity.

This standard is intended for use by pipeline operators and others who must manage pipeline integrity. It provides flexibility for an operator to tailor the process to specific pipeline situations. This standard covers the four components of ECDA: pre-assessment, indirect inspections, direct examinations, and post assessment.

ECDA is a continuous improvement process. Through successive applications, ECDA should identify and address locations at which corrosion activity has occurred, is occurring, or may occur.
